Transaction 39d4563d70c6a3f5def71e1f8f530b6aaee9d2e9fa689c04dcd2986b2630e60f
1 Input
2 Outputs
- 39d4563d70c6a3f5def71e1f8f530b6aaee9d2e9fa689c04dcd2986b2630e60f:0
- 39d4563d70c6a3f5def71e1f8f530b6aaee9d2e9fa689c04dcd2986b2630e60f:1
value 1267830
address 3JBKwCbfQQeGULrXGe5UaZ7x197RnDup3u
value 10498924
address 3HEwhtECy81B6dizhfVszLoBZMvLPfboLR